Preparing the Grilled Cheese Burrito

Creating a grilled cheese burrito at home is an exciting culinary adventure that combines comfort food favorites in a single delicious package. If you’re ready to dive into this tasty creation, let’s walk through the steps for preparing the ultimate grilled cheese burrito.

Cook the Beef

Start by preparing your beef filling, which serves as the hearty base for your burrito. Here’s how to do it right:

  • Choose the Right Beef: Opt for ground beef with around 15-20% fat content. This ratio keeps your beef juicy and flavorful.
  • Seasoning is Key: In a pan over medium heat, add a bit of olive oil, then toss in your ground beef. Season it well with salt, black pepper, and your favorite taco spices. For some extra flavor, you might consider adding garlic powder or onion powder.
  • Cook Until Browned: Stir occasionally and cook until the beef is browned and fully cooked, about 5-7 minutes.
  • Drain Excess Fat: Once cooked, drain any excess fat from the pan. You want the beef to stay juicy, but not greasy!

Warm the Tortillas

A warm tortilla makes rolling your grilled cheese burrito much easier and more enjoyable! Here’s how to warm them properly:

  • A Skillet Works Wonders: On medium heat, place your tortilla in the skillet for about 10-20 seconds on each side until they’re warmed and pliable.
  • Microwave Method: If you’re short on time, you can stack a few tortillas, wrap them in a damp paper towel, and microwave for about 30 seconds.

Remember, the key here is to avoid cracking the tortillas while rolling. Keeping them warm helps ensure flexibility!

Roll It Up

Now comes the most crucial part—the rolling!

  • Folding Technique: Start by folding the sides of the tortilla inward, then pull the bottom flap up over the filling. Tightly roll upwards until you reach the top.
  • Seal with Cheese: To keep it all together, sprinkle a bit more cheese at the top of your burrito before rolling to help it glue together.

This method ensures a well-constructed burrito that won’t spill its guts during grilling!

Grill With Cheese

Finally, it’s time to grill your masterpiece. This is what takes your grilled cheese burrito to another level of indulgence!

  • Heat the Skillet: Wipe your pan clean and place it back on medium heat. Add a pat of butter to the skillet—it gives a lovely flavor and crispy texture.
  • Grill Until Golden: Place your burrito seam-side down in the hot skillet. After a few minutes, check to see if it’s beautifully golden brown, then flip and grill the other side.
  • Melted Cheese Moment: For an extra cheesy experience, you can reduce the heat and cover the skillet for a minute to thoroughly melt the cheese inside.

Cooking Tips and Notes for Grilled Cheese Burrito

Storing Leftovers

If you find yourself with extra grilled cheese burritos, don’t worry! Make sure they cool down completely before wrapping them tightly in foil or placing them in an airtight container. They’ll keep well in the fridge for about 2-3 days. To maintain the best flavor and texture, try to consume them within that timeframe.

Reheating Methods

Reheating can be an art form! For optimal results, use a skillet on low heat. This method allows the burrito to crisp up while warming the interior. You can also use the oven set at 350°F (175°C) wrapped in foil, allowing it to heat evenly while retaining moisture.
